Transaction 425fbc99a5c2b6d3397bf1ed10387a1a1425fdc03360e04979fc5fca12441968
1 Input
1 Output
-
425fbc99a5c2b6d3397bf1ed10387a1a1425fdc03360e04979fc5fca12441968:0
- value
- 22859405
- script pubkey
- OP_0 OP_PUSHBYTES_20 589a90b7dbb14b4c1bc8f8350d606073bd5b5682
- address
- bc1qtzdfpd7mk995cx7glq6s6crqww74k45zt39e9f